NCR BLN NEB 8203 THIRD INTERIM REPORT Dc,scrg tion of Deficiency A pipe failure of the noneafety grade Steam Generator Startup and Recirculation System in the Auxiliary Building could result in a harsh environment that exceeds the qualification limits for safety-related electrical equipment. Failure of nearby safety-related equipment in one system train because of the harsh environment caused by the pipe break coupled with an assumed failure in the same safety system in the other train may result in a situation that could adversely affect safe shutdown of the plant.

The cause of this deficiency was determined to be lack of sufficient pipe l

break analysis criteria at the time of system design. No other TVA

- facilities are affected by this deficiency.

- ' Interim Prof ess Design work relating to the system relocation / enclosure is continuing. The system design document, the design criteria drawings, and mechanical piping drawings have been revised to reflect the requirement that the startup and recirculation system piping in the auxilia:'y building be isolated from the building environment.

Still in progress is the revision to civil design drawings (concrote and steel) of the pipe chases and pump enclosures required to implement the piping isc.1ation.
